A key component of termite defense is developing a lasting chemical barrier around the structure. This is attained by injecting a liquid termiticide into the soil that surrounds the building's external edge. In lots of neighborhoods where homes rest on concrete pieces, the chemical is provided straight into the ground to remove any gaps in the secured zone. Contemporary treatment techniques often utilize non‑repellent solutions, which are especially potent due to the fact that foraging termites can not pick up the item as they pass through the cured earth. Instead of being repelled, they carry the active ingredient back to their primary nest and distribute it among their mates, eventually damaging the nest. This technique offers a far stronger and longer‑lasting solution than the older, repellent‑type barriers.
Where the ground is mainly paved or owners opt for another method, physical barriers or keeping track of systems offer an extremely efficient solution. A physical termite barrier, such as a stainless‑steel mesh or a layer of graded stone, can be set up during building to obstruct termites from slipping through concealed openings. In already‑built homes, these barriers are typically matched by baiting stations put inconspicuously at routine periods around the home. The stations hold timber pieces that tempt termites before they reach your home, and as soon as activity is spotted, a specialized growth‑regulating bait is presented. This proactive method is prized for its ecological precision and its capability to obstruct emerging colonies moving from surrounding bushland throughout Australia.
